General Motors announced the appointment of Paul Edwards as U.S. vice president of Chevrolet Marketing, effective immediately. He replaces Chris Perry, who left abruptly.
Edwards, 44, has served as executive director of General Motors Global Marketing since 2010 where he was responsible for global media operations, agency management, marketing alliances, licensing, branded entertainment and global auto shows. Edwards will answer to Chevrolet Global Chief Marketing Officer Tim Mahoney in his new position.
“Paul’s broad experience in virtually all aspects of automotive marketing, across multiple brands, makes him a great fit for Chevrolet as we continue to build on our strong product momentum here in the U.S.,” Mahoney said in a statement.
Edwards began his career with GM in 1992 at Cadillac, where he held various sales and marketing positions until he was named manager of Chevrolet Advertising in 2003.
